Understanding Morphsuits: Are They Truly Unisex?

Morphsuits are designed to be stretchy, form-fitting costumes that cover the entire body, including the face, hands, and feet. Their material is typically a blend of spandex and polyester, which enables them to stretch and conform to various body shapes comfortably. Because of this stretchy fabric and the nature of the suit’s design, Morphsuits are generally considered unisex.

Unlike traditional costumes that may have more rigid cuts or gender-specific tailoring, Morphsuits provide a one-size-fits-many approach. This means that males, females, and children can all wear the same style without the designer having to create separate versions for each gender.

Choosing the Right Size: A Guide for Different Body Shapes

Though Morphsuits are unisex, selecting the right size is crucial to ensure comfort and the best look. Because the suits are tight-fitting, a poor fit can limit mobility or affect the overall appearance. Here are some key tips to consider when choosing your Morphsuit size:

1. Know Your Measurements

Before purchasing a Morphsuit, take accurate measurements of your height, chest, waist, and hips. Most Morphsuit brands provide size charts to help you compare your measurements and pick the best fit. Keep in mind that because the material is stretchy, you should choose a size that closely matches your largest measurement to avoid discomfort.

2. Consider Your Body Shape

Different body shapes might require specific considerations. For example:

  • Hourglass shapes: Since Morphsuits are stretchy, they can accommodate curves well, but choosing a size based on the widest measurement (often hips or chest) is essential.
  • Athletic builds: Those with broader shoulders or muscular arms might want to size up slightly for added comfort, especially if the suit feels restrictive.
  • Taller or petite frames: Height is also important. Some brands offer tall or petite variations to ensure the length of the arms and legs fits properly.

3. Read Reviews and Customer Feedback

One of the best ways to ensure you’re selecting the right size is to check reviews from other buyers with similar body types. They often share helpful tips on sizing up or down and how the suit fits in real life.

4. Keep Mobility in Mind

Morphsuits should allow you to move freely, so if you find a suit that feels too tight, it might be worth trying the next size up. Remember that the fabric will stretch but can only do so much before it becomes uncomfortable or potentially tears.

Additional Tips for a Great Morphsuit Experience

  • Wear appropriate undergarments: Given the suit’s tightness and thin fabric, wearing seamless or skin-colored undergarments can enhance comfort and appearance.
  • Practice putting it on: Morphsuits can be tricky to put on at first, especially when covering the face. Taking your time and moving slowly can help prevent damage.
  • Care and washing: Follow the manufacturer’s instructions carefully to maintain the suit’s elasticity and vibrant colors.
